Driveway construction services involve designing, planning, and building durable surfaces that provide access to residential, commercial, or industrial properties. These projects typically include site preparation, grading, and the installation of materials such as concrete, asphalt, or pavers. Skilled contractors ensure that the driveway is properly sloped for drainage, level, and capable of supporting vehicle weight over time. This process helps create a smooth, functional entrance that enhances both the appearance and utility of a property.

The overview below groups typical Driveway Construction proj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Orting, WA.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or driveway repairs, such as crack filling or patching, usually range from $250-$600. Many routine maintenance jobs fall within this middle range, depending on the extent of the damage.

Resurfacing or Overlay - Resurfacing projects, which involve applying a new layer over existing driveways, often cost between $1,000 and $3,000. Larger or more detailed overlays can push costs higher but remain common within this range.

Full Driveway Replacement - Complete driveway replacements typically fall between $4,000 and $8,000 for standard projects, with more complex or larger-scale jobs reaching $10,000 or more. Most projects tend to stay within the middle to upper part of this range.

Custom or Large-Scale Projects - Larger, more intricate driveway construction or extensive custom designs can exceed $10,000, with some high-end projects reaching $15,000 or beyond. These are less common but represent the upper end of typical costs for driveway services in the Orting area.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What types of driveways can local contractors build? Local contractors can construct various types of driveways, including concrete, asphalt, gravel, and paver options, to suit different needs and preferences.

How do local service providers prepare the site for driveway construction? They typically assess the area, clear existing materials, and perform grading to ensure a stable, level foundation for the new driveway.

What materials are commonly used in driveway construction? Common materials include concrete, asphalt, gravel, and interlocking pavers, each offering different durability and aesthetic qualities.

Can local contractors handle driveway repairs and resurfacing? Yes, many local service providers offer repair and resurfacing services to extend the lifespan of existing driveways.

What should be considered when choosing a driveway type? Factors like durability, maintenance, aesthetic preferences, and the property's usage can influence the best choice for a driveway.
